clang-format is incorrectly thinking the parameter parens are part of a cast 
operation, this is resulting in there sometimes being not space between the 
paren and the noexcept (and other keywords like volatile etc..)

  void operator++(int) noexcept;
  void operator++(int &) noexcept;
  void operator delete(void *, std::size_t, const std::nothrow_t &)noexcept;

Index: clang/lib/Format/TokenAnnotator.cpp
===================================================================
--- clang/lib/Format/TokenAnnotator.cpp
+++ clang/lib/Format/TokenAnnotator.cpp
@@ -1611,6 +1611,12 @@
     if (Tok.Next->is(tok::question))
       return false;
 
+    // Functions which end with decorations like volatile, noexcept are 
unlikely
+    // to be casts.
+    if (Tok.Next->isOneOf(tok::kw_noexcept, tok::kw_volatile, tok::kw_const,
+                          tok::kw_throw, tok::l_square, tok::arrow))
+      return false;
+
     // As Java has no function types, a "(" after the ")" likely means that 
this
     // is a cast.
     if (Style.Language == FormatStyle::LK_Java && Tok.Next->is(tok::l_paren))
